Biochemical and Physiological Mechanisms
Potent estrogen receptor silent antagonist. Inhibits 17β-estradiol stimulation of luciferase activity (IC50= 0.025μM); potently inhibits the growth of estrogen-sensitive human MCF-7 breast cancer cellsin vitro(IC50~ 1 nM).

Description
This compound belongs to the class of organic compounds known as 2-phenylindoles. These are indoles substituted at the 2-position with a phenyl group.
